The Camper for Break Bad RV Building Set is a 986-piece creative building block kit designed for ages 8-14. Made from high-quality, non-toxic ABS material, this set allows fans to recreate iconic scenes from the movie while enhancing their creative thinking skills. With easy-to-follow instructions, it's perfect for family bonding and imaginative play.

Bigger than expected!
The pieces are the same scale as LEGO, not the micro bricks. They look identical to real legos, and only slightly differ in quality (they’re a little harder to put together than normal legos, stiffer). There were many bags and I was very pleasantly surprised! Great price & great quality toy.

Missing a few pieces
Instructions are a little unclear in some of the steps (maybe I’m just dumb) and along the way I noticed that I was missing a few pieces here and there. I also noticed that some of the pieces needed some force to snap into place. Other than that the set looks great when fully assembled.

Not worth the headache
I’ve recently gotten into the hobby of building with bricks like this and I have to say this is easily the worst thing I have had to build.Points:- Instructions are terribly made that left me missing parts of the build- While building, the portions you make offer little to no stability, causing you to accidentally break pieces off- The bricks themselves do not snap together or seat nicely with each otherIn short, do not buy this if you’re trying to relax because it’s more aggravating than anything else

This camper is a mobile meth lab
Although I saw breaking bad, I forgot the camper was a mobile meth lab. My kids and I put it together and they took out all the "weird camping equipment" and replaced it with furniture from other sets, but I wouldn't have bought it if I had realized that. Also, it was hard to put together- it broke a lot and I had to get innovative to keep it together. My soon took the doors off because they just didn't work. But if you get it cheap and are a good lego builder and/or really want a mobile meth lab, its probably fine.
